Aussie journalist on drug charges
http://www.heraldsun.news.com.au/common/story_page/0,5478,9395096%5E1702,00.html
26apr04
A MELBOURNE journalist has been charged with drug offences after allegedly being caught at Melbourne Airport with two kilograms of cocaine strapped to his body.
Royal Turanga Eira Abbott, 51, a New Zealand citizen, arrived in Melbourne on a flight from Singapore last Monday.
Customs officers selected Abbott for a baggage search and allegedly detected a high reading for cocaine on his wallet, the Australian Customs Service said in a statement.
Customs officers conducted a frisk search which allegedly revealed a body-pack containing two kilograms of cocaine, secured to his body by a Velcro back brace.
Abbott, who works for the national news agency AAP, appeared in Melbourne Magistrates Court on Friday charged with one count of importing a prohibited import and one count of possessing a prohibited import.
He entered no plea and was remanded in custody by magistrate Barbara Cotterell to reappear in the same court for a committal mention on July 12.
